Monday Mixtape: Whitney Houston

Whitney Houston has always sung my life’s soundtrack. I regret that I haven’t done a tribute to her up until now. My mother has begged me for 2 years to do a mix. I made a cd for her but I didn’t take the time to do a full fledged mix. I still remember when she brought home Whitney’s first album. She and my father would dance in the living room: slow dance and work the floor to her fast hits. When they would go out and leave me to babysit, I remember listening to her slow jams. I would sit, obsess over my latest crush, think and cry over the lyrics. As I grew older, Whitney Houston continued to touch my life with her music. Ever since I found out about her death, I have been devastated. My mother said that she thought I would do a good job with this mix and I really hope I did. Thank you Whitney. Thank you. And thank you Mommy. You have always guided my music life and I’m thankful that I had mother like you to show me what real music is and was.

Monday Mixtape: Bobby Womack vs David Ruffin

This is the first of 4 mixtapes that were inspired while I was on my vacation. Bobby Womack Vs David Ruffin. Both were powerhouses in the R&B scene during the 70′s and early 80′s and my heart has a soft spot for both of them.
